Hello everyone,

I'm working on evaporation and condensation in a straight tube. I had no problem with evaporation but condensation doesn't work. In simulation I used steady conditions, vof model (evaporation-condensation Lee), viscous k-omega SSt, primary phase water-liquid and secondary water-vapour. In material properties changed state enthalpy: for liquid on 0 and for vapour on -4.398771e+07. In boundary conditions: mass flow steam 0,2kg/s temp 375K and wall temp 270K. Solutions methods: coupled with volume fraction, pressure PRESTO, pseudo transient, hybrid initialization and 250 iterations.
In results: Residuals and temperature contours looks good but there was no phase transition.

Appreciate any help
